As nouns, Vipera aspis is a hyponym of viper; that is, Vipera aspis is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than viper:
  • viper: venomous Old World snakes characterized by hollow venom-conducting fangs in the upper jaw
  • Vipera aspis: of southern Europe; similar to but smaller than the adder
